First time in the "new" Huxley's which has moved about 20 metres and is under new ownership since our last visit a few years back . Very warm welcome and a nice warm room thanks to the log fire. Service prompt, competent, friendly and even though we were a bit early for lunch and almost too late for breakfast, having something from the lunch and breakfast menus was no problem. The food when it arrived was superb. Freshly made, generous portions and good quality ingredients. The two very charming ladies who appear to run (own?) it had a rare thing - a positive, service and customer orientated mindset. No sharp intake of breath when asked for something. A BIG improvement on the previous incarnation (which wasn't bad). Unfortunately it is 400 miles south of us so we look forward to a Huxley's in Aberfeldy.

I have been a fairly regular customer at Huxley's for close on 2-years. A warm welcome, good service with great coffee and food always guaranteed. The icing on the cake, if I can use that metaphor, was the 4-cosy chairs by the wood burning stove and large fireplace, which in winter, in the Cotswolds, was one of the best places to be. Even if you couldn't get a seat by the fire, the warm atmosphere was all around. Not anymore! In an attempt to squeeze more tables in I suspect, the 4-arm chairs have gone, and the stove is no longer lit as the replacement table is too close. Big shame as the place has lost some of its original atmosphere. No doubt I will be judged too picky but I'm sure there will be many others who will miss the fire. Hopefully only a temporary thing
